Outlook Calendar Synchronization with DataCRM

In this article, we'll teach you how to synchronize Outlook with your CRM calendar.

Actualizado esta semana

Outlook synchronization with the CRM allows you to link your calendar with your activities within the CRM, helping you automatically create your activities within the Outlook calendar. This way, you can view the information associated with the activity, such as the contact, client, and description, in your Outlook calendar.

You must ensure that the CRM and Outlook time zones are the same so that activities carried out from the platform to the calendar are accurate. If not, the activities will be created with different times.

2. Set equal time zones

To confirm that the time zones are the same, follow these steps:

  • From the CRM

    Log in to your CRM and continue the following process:

    1. Click on your username and then on 'My Preferences'.

      There you can check what time zone your CRM is in.

      If you want to change the time zone, simply click on it.

      Then, open the list of available options and select the one that suits you best.

  • From Outlook

    Sign in to your email by clicking here , and there continue with the following step-by-step instructions:

    1. Press the settings gear.

    2. Press the 'General' menu.

    3. Click on 'Time Zone'.

    4. Go to Time Zone and set it to the same as the CRM. If they match, skip this step.

3. Synchronization process

Enter the CRM and follow the step-by-step instructions:

  1. Press the 'Calendars' menu.

  2. Click on 'Calendar List'.

  3. Press the hidden tab on the left edge of the screen.

  4. Click 'Microsoft Calendar' and then 'Access with Outlook'.

    The system will prompt you to log in with your Outlook account.

  5. Press the 'Yes' button to grant sync permission.

    After accepting, you'll be taken to the canvas. Your Outlook calendar is now synced. When you add tasks that are in the planned status and are marked for appearance on the calendars, you'll be able to view them in the Outlook calendar.

4. Activate calendar permissions

Log in to your CRM and continue step by step:

  1. Tap the gear and then 'CRM Settings'.

  2. Click the 'Study' menu and then click 'Drop-down List Editor'.

  3. Select the information below:

    • Select module: Activities

    • Select Activities drop-down list: Activity Type

  4. Check that the calendar checkbox is active in the activity types. If not, click the box and activate it.

Remember that if the calendar check is not active, what will happen is that the activity will not be synchronized with the Outlook calendar.

5. Remove synchronization

Log in to your CRM and continue step by step:

  1. Press the 'Calendars' menu.

  2. Click on 'Calendar List'.

  3. Press the hidden tab on the left edge of the screen.

  4. Click 'Microsoft Calendar' and then 'Sync Eliminator'.

    The CRM will show you a message confirming that the synchronization was successfully deleted.
